Benefits of Upgrading the Boost Pipe
Upgrading the boost pipe in your Ford Ranger can unlock significant performance enhancements. A high-quality boost pipe allows for better airflow, which improves engine efficiency. When air flows smoothly into the turbocharger, it enhances power output, giving you a noticeable increase in acceleration.
Another benefit is temperature control. Stock pipes often restrict airflow and heat dissipation. Upgraded materials, like aluminium or silicone, are designed to withstand higher temperatures while keeping intake air cooler. Cooler air means denser oxygen enters the engine, translating to more horsepower.
Durability is also a key advantage of an upgraded boost pipe. Factory-installed components may wear out over time or become brittle under extreme conditions. Aftermarket options typically offer improved resilience against cracking and pressure buildup.

Choosing the Right Ford Ranger 3.2 Intercooler Pipe
Making the right choice is crucial when upgrading your Ford Ranger 3.2 Intercooler Pipe. Various options are on the market, each offering different benefits. Consider material, diameter, and design when selecting the best boost pipe for your vehicle.
A common choice among enthusiasts is aluminium or stainless steel pipes. They are lightweight and durable, providing better airflow than stock options. Look for mandrel-bent designs that eliminate airflow restrictions, which can significantly improve performance.
The diameter of the boost pipe also plays an essential role in overall efficiency. A larger diameter may enhance performance but could require additional tuning adjustments. Before making a purchase, check manufacturer specifications to ensure compatibility with your existing system.

Removing the Old Ford Ranger Cold Side Intercooler Pipe
Before installing your new Ford Ranger Cold Side Intercooler Pipe, carefully remove the old one. If your Ford Ranger has been running recently, start by letting it cool down. This will prevent burns and make handling easier.
Next, locate the existing boost pipe. It’s typically connected between the turbocharger and the intercooler. Use a wrench or socket set to loosen any clamps holding it in place. Be gentle; you don’t want to damage surrounding components during this process.
Once you’ve removed the clamps, gently pull the old boost pipe from its connections. Wiggling might help dislodge it without causing harm if it’s stuck due to heat or age. Keep an eye on any gaskets that may come off with it; you’ll want those for reference later.
As you remove the old component, inspect it for signs of wear or cracks. Understanding its condition can give insight into what performance upgrades are possible with your new Ford Ranger installation. A clear view of what’s being replaced sets you up for success as you move forward.

Testing and Tuning: Ford Ranger 3.2 Intercooler Hose
After installing your new Ford Ranger 3.2 Intercooler Hose, testing and tuning are crucial to ensure optimal performance. Start by checking all connections for leaks. A simple visual inspection can help identify any issues before you hit the road.
Next, take your Ranger out for a test drive in various conditions. Pay attention to how the engine responds under different loads and RPM ranges. This will give you valuable insight into whether the upgrade delivers on its promise of enhanced performance.
Once you’ve gathered some data from your driving experience, it’s time to tune your vehicle if needed. Consider using a tuner or an ECU remap to adjust fuel delivery and timing based on the improved airflow from your new boost pipe. This can unlock even more power while maintaining efficiency.
Keep an eye on gauges during this process. Monitor parameters like boost pressure and air-fuel ratio closely. Adjustments may be necessary as you refine your setup for maximum gains without sacrificing reliability or drivability.
